Job description

Work setting: Hybrid with an average of 2 office days per week dependent on meetings

Salary: £36,967 to £39,608

Contract: Permanent, Full-time (35 hours per week)

Location: London

Are you an experienced Executive Assistant who is used to providing confidential, efficient and adaptable support to senior leaders? Do you thrive in a dynamic environment where your contributions directly impact the success of the organisation?

TPP are recruiting an Executive Assistant on behalf of our client, a charity focused on providing support to young people facing health issues.

The Role

As an Executive Assistant, you will support the Chief Executive and Chief Operating Officer, ensuring they are effectively connected with the wider organisation and external stakeholders. You will provide confidential, efficient, and adaptable support, working alongside a dedicated PA team to ensure seamless governance and decision-making processes.

Main responsibilities

  • Serve as the first point of contact for the Chief Executive and Chief Operating Officer.
  • Maintain the highest level of confidentiality and adherence to internal policies.
  • Manage calendars and schedules, prioritising requests and appointments.
  • Organise and support meetings, including preparing agendas and briefing materials.
  • Assist with the production of Board packs and liaise with Board members.
  • Coordinate travel arrangements and manage correspondence.
  • Screen calls and enquiries, addressing them as appropriate.
  • Conduct research and follow up on action items, ensuring timely completion.
  • Produce documents, reports, and presentations as needed.
  • Attend select meetings, take notes, and ensure follow-up on actions.
  • Handle HR and Finance administrative tasks, including budget tracking and expense management.
  • Collaborate with the business support team, providing cover during absences and peak times.

Essential requirements:

  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ills.
  • Experience as an Executive Assistant at a senior level.
  • Strong organisational skills, including diary and travel management.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office and virtual meeting technology.
  • Eye for detail and a commitment to confidentiality and GDPR compliance.
  • Initiative to anticipate problems and provide effective solutions.
  • Ability to work flexibly and professionally.
